Output 78609639af317b8ef6ef6aaeec2f27cfa7a8803fda36e9ea44b11bde8a3f1c7e:14

value
1155474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d39cde08d16f933777945153a0b45dbcea3d50ee OP_EQUAL
address
3LyvRMQMZwresTopxZUphgxocvwkmarsTj
transaction
78609639af317b8ef6ef6aaeec2f27cfa7a8803fda36e9ea44b11bde8a3f1c7e
confirmations
134463
spent
true